    What do you think puppy mills are? They BREED, animals, therefore, they ARE BREEDERS. I'm sorry, but no responsible breeder would *ever* sell a puppy to a pet store.

    Stopping the sale of puppies in pet stores would DEFINITELY help, it would not help puppy mills. People do not buy directly from puppy mills, like Karen said...the dogs are in awful conditions, the public is not allowed in there.

    If they stopped selling puppies in pet stores, puppy mills would no longer have anywhere to supply puppies too. Pet stores could have pets from shelters instead.

    I've asked our local pet stores where they get puppies from too. There is no way to find out if they are lying or not, unless you get the actual address information about the breeder, and visit them for yourself.

    And I don't know where in the world you are going with the tattoo thing.....what does that matter? Even if they are AKC purebred that doesn't mean they came from a good breeder.
